- Stop Faucet Drips with a Quick Adjustment
A leaky faucet is more than a nuisance—it can lead to higher water bills over time. One useful tip is to check the faucet handle or valve stem for tightness. Sometimes, a small adjustment can reduce the dripping while also easing the strain on internal components.

- Clear Slow Drains with Baking Soda and Vinegar
One of the simplest and most effective plumbing hacksinvolves natural ingredients. A combination of baking soda and white vinegar can help loosen minor buildup in bathroom or kitchen drains. After letting the solution sit for 15–20 minutes, flush the drain with hot water to help restore better flow. - Remove Sink Clogs with a Wet/Dry Vacuum
Clogs in bathroom or kitchen sinks can be addressed by using a wet/dry vacuum. When applied with a proper seal, the suction can help dislodge minor obstructions like hair or food debris. This method is gentle on pipes and avoids the use of harsh chemicals that could damage older systems. - Quiet Loud Pipes with Simple Padding
Pipes that knock or rattle can be distracting, especially in multi-story homes. Wrapping exposed pipes with foam insulation or rubber padding helps absorb vibrations. This is particularly helpful in homes with older plumbing setups where pipes may not be securely fastened. - Detect Toilet Tank Leaks with Food Coloring
To check for hidden leaks in your toilet, add a few drops of food coloring to the tank and wait 30 minutes without flushing. If color appears in the bowl, there’s a leak between the tank and the bowl—usually caused by a worn flapper. Addressing this early helps save water and prevent long-term wear on your plumbing.
